The Golden Age Of Scalzi Is Now

The Human Division (Old Man's War, #5)The Human Division by John Scalzi
My rating: 5 of 5 stars

I always love John Scalzi's books.

He is the master of mixing compelling science fiction stories with characters you care about, action, suspense, mystery, and always, always humor. I very seldom interrupt my wife's reading to read something aloud, but I do that (did it last night) when I read John Scalzi. And then we laugh. He's not writing comedy, he's writing humans, but when done right, with a light touch, which includes a wry tone that is not overdone, humans are hilarious. (Dialogue especially.)

This is the 5th book in the Old Man's War series, so the universe is well-established, though the characters here are mostly new. It still works. I'll read books that aren't fun on every page or every chapter, pushing through, but what a pleasure to read a book that's entertaining pretty much every moment.

Also, fwiw, Scalzi is known for writing strong female characters, and he does not disappoint. As always, some of the best characters in this novel are smart, kick-ass women in leadership roles.

Fun novel, well written. Recommended.
